TEMPLE BOY AND DERAAS DIARY, FOLLOW THE JOURNEY UNTIL ITS RELEASE





Deraa’s pre-signing activities at SmallFace records was mostly surrounded with making new music and developing his creative and composition abilities. SmallFace organized four successful music production and recording boot camps, these camps featured outstanding music producers such as Magik, Dheveen, Joeson (Ayo) and Yoody. More than thirteen songs were recorded during this boot camp. The label stated that the magnificent outcome of this project put their best A&R’s in an indecisive position in regards to selection for Deraa’s first body of work, They advanced into selecting three which consists of August, Dialogue and party animal, to create the project Temple boy, as a test run mechanism to monitor Deraa’s progress when it comes to the marketing of body of works. The story behind temple boy explains how the culture from the pre-colonial era introduced a diverse kind of melody to the altar boys in religious communities in Africa such as Christianity, in which Deraa was a strong partaker.


The administration and influence of the colonizers amongst the Igbos was quite visible amongst musical talents who served in the church which was their landing ground for colonization, Deraa in his memory regress adventures discovered some of these melodies and brought them back to life.


The three tracks gave a positive receptive affirmation to a bigger project release and fostered a decision for an album by the label just two months after Temple Boy was created.





Eleven tracks were picked from the creative outcome of the boot camp, and the tracks were specifically surrounding one topic and one agenda, a testament of Deraa’s experience with love; from the impact of long distance relationship and finally losing the one love.

Deraa also claims that the melodies that initiated the creation of this project were gotten from other lifetimes through private hypnotherapeutic practices.

After the selection and arrangements of these tracks on the project, SmallFace record sprofessional A&Rs discovered that every song on the project has an inter-connection and storyline which prompted an album description analogy.
